## Runbook: Gridform Crossword Generator

Generator stalls when the wordbank sync fails. Symptoms: puzzles ship with duplicate clues or empty grids. Check the sync daemon first; restart only after confirming the Lexhold upstream is reachable. Do not regenerate published puzzles — editors hand-tune them. If a full rebuild is needed, queue it off-peak and cap workers at four. Rebuild jobs authenticate against Lexhold with the service key directly below.

gateway credential: vxb11-v9yOsaxubAz

Subject: Template rendering — 38% latency reduction ahead of the sync

Team,

Ahead of the weekly eng sync, a summary of the Quillpress rendering work: we replaced the per-request template parse with a precompiled cache keyed on layout version, which cut median render time from 42ms to 26ms on the Harborline tier. Tail latency improved even more sharply once we removed the recursive partial lookup. Full benchmark tables are in the sync doc. The numbers were gathered on the build identified just below.

build token for kagaf-hahof: htk14_9d3d4d26d7d8de

Subject: Quickstore 4.2 — bloom filter now fronts the KV layer

Plugin authors: starting with this release, Quickstore places a bloom filter ahead of the key-value store. Negative lookups return faster; false positives fall through safely. No API changes are required on your side. Verify your plugin against the staging build referenced below.

session token of fahif-tadup = htk3_9c7